Deadline Now - 1-20-2017 - Lucas County Criminal Justice System
 
 
 
Lucas County has far more people behind bars than our leaders would like to have - and that's costing taxpayers a small fortune. Besides that , the corrections population is anything but demographically representative of the county as a whole. African-Americans are slightly less than one-fifty of the overall population but are 53 percent of those in the county jail. The good news is that last year, the county was award a $1.75 million dollar MacArthur Grant to come up with reforms to try to create a fair and more effective criminal justice system. Well, what's happened so far with that?
